Baseball Preview: Buffalo Bison vs. Butler Bears

The Buffalo Bison will head out on the road to face off against the Butler Bears at 4:30 p.m. on Tuesday. Buffalo is no doubt hoping to put an end to an 11-game streak of away losses dating back to last season.

Monday just wasn't the day for Buffalo's offense. They took a 5-0 hit to the loss column at the hands of Iberia on Monday.

Kaden Abmeyer spent all seven innings on the mound, and it's clear why: he surrendered three earned (and two unearned) runs on eight hits.

Meanwhile, Butler narrowly escaped with a victory as the team sidled past Harrisonville 5-3. The win made it back-to-back victories for Butler.

Butler also let their pitcher toss all seven innings and he was also dialed-in: Brock Lines gave up three earned runs on four hits.

At the plate, Butler's win was truly a team effort as five different players contributed at least one hit. One of them was Eli Cox, who scored a run while going 1-for-3.

Buffalo's loss dropped their record down to 1-14. As for Butler, their victory ended a four-game drought at home and bumped them up to 7-9.
